
Java_Spring笔记
文章平均质量分 55
一些笔记
今日晴转多雲
这个作者很懒,什么都没留下…
展开
-
javaweb的四大作用域
JavaWeb的四大作用域为:PageContext,ServletRequest,HttpSession,ServletContext;PageContext域:作用范围是整个JSP页面,是四大作用域中最小的一个;生命周期是当对JSP的请求时开始,当响应结束时销毁。ServletRequest域:作用范围是整个请求链(请求转发也存在);生命周期是在service方法调用前由服务器创建,传入service方法。整个请求结束,request生命结束。**HttpSession域:**作用范围是一次会话。原创 2021-07-26 09:13:59 · 715 阅读 · 0 评论 -
全局统一返回实现方案未完成
https://blog.youkuaiyun.com/u013241093/article/details/105231883/?utm_medium=distribute.pc_relevant.none-task-blog-2defaultbaidujs_baidulandingword~default-0.control&spm=1001.2101.3001.4242https://blog.youkuaiyun.com/suprezheng/article/details/105458191?utm_mediu原创 2021-07-23 08:56:01 · 136 阅读 · 0 评论 -
统一验证@Valid
@Valid首先,我们在 Maven 配置中引入 @valid 的依赖:如果你是 springboot 项目,那么可以不用引入了,已经引入了,他就存在于最核心的 web 开发包里面。<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> <version>转载 2021-07-22 10:54:29 · 312 阅读 · 1 评论 -
SpringMVC中请求转发与重定向
请求转发,直接使用jsp文件名。这样做的前提是对应的jsp页面在自己配置的视图解析器路径下。<bean id="internalResourceViewResolver" class="org.springframework.web.servlet.view.InternalResourceViewResolver"> <!--前缀--> <property name="prefix" value="/WEB-INF/jsp/"></proper原创 2021-07-21 16:31:37 · 133 阅读 · 0 评论 -
Http详解
HTTP方法 主要列举常见的以及常用的方法。 GET:请求资源; POST:传输资源; HEAD:获取报文首部数据; PUT:更新资源;(应用不多) DELETE:删除资源;(应用更少)POST和GET的区别 1、GET 在浏览器回退时是无害的,而POST会再次提交请求。 2、GET 请求会被浏览器主动缓存,POST不会,除非手动设置。 3、GET 请求参数会被完整保留在浏览器历史记录中,POST不会保存。 .原创 2021-07-21 15:39:16 · 189 阅读 · 0 评论 -
@ResponseBody/@RequestBody用法
方法/步骤@RequestBody的作用其实是将json格式的数据转为java对象。后台接收前台传来的json对象用PostMapping例一:向表中批量插入数据举个批量插入数据的例子,Controller层的写法如下图所示:批量向表中插入两条数据,这里的 saveBatchNovel()方法已经封装了 JPA的 saveAll() 方法。body 里面的 json 语句的 key 值要与后端实体类的属性一一对应例二:后端解析json数据上述示例是传递到实体类中的具体写法,那么如果传原创 2021-07-21 15:29:44 · 2996 阅读 · 0 评论 -
@GetMapping@PostMapping用法
https://blog.youkuaiyun.com/weixin_41167961/article/details/118102153当方法中的参数为@RequestParam、@PathVaiable、无参的情况下使用@GetMapping当方法中的参数为@RequestBody、多参、对象参数的情况下使用@PostMapping原创 2021-07-20 20:51:30 · 946 阅读 · 0 评论 -
@RequestParam,@PathParam,@PathVariable注解区别(获取前端传来的参数)
https://blog.youkuaiyun.com/u011410529/article/details/66974974原创 2021-07-20 16:18:40 · 3653 阅读 · 0 评论 -
mybatis的一对多,多对一,以及多对对的配置和使用
https://blog.youkuaiyun.com/znoone/article/details/87645969原创 2021-07-20 10:19:30 · 148 阅读 · 0 评论 -
Springmvc原理
SpringMvc 简单介绍下你对springMVC的理解?Spring MVC Framework有这样一些特点:它是基于组件技术的.全部的应用对象,无论控制器和视图,还是业务对象之类的都是java组件.并且和Spring提供的其他基础结构紧密集成.不依赖于Servlet API(目标虽是如此,但是在实现的时候确实是依赖于Servlet的)可以任意使用各种视图技术,而不仅仅局限于JSP支持各种请求资源的映射策略它应是易于扩展的SpringMVC的工作流程?1. 用户发送请求至前端控制器原创 2021-07-20 09:57:08 · 238 阅读 · 0 评论